LCOV - code coverage report
Current view: top level - resolve - resolve_messages.cc (source / functions) Hit Total Coverage
Test: report.info Lines: 2 2 100.0 %
Date: 2012-05-15 Functions: 1 1 100.0 %
Legend: Lines: hit not hit | Branches: + taken - not taken # not executed Branches: 0 0 -

           Branch data     Line data    Source code
       1                 :            : // File created from ../../../src/lib/resolve/resolve_messages.mes on Mon May 14 10:33:54 2012
       2                 :            : 
       3                 :            : #include <cstddef>
       4                 :            : #include <log/message_types.h>
       5                 :            : #include <log/message_initializer.h>
       6                 :            : 
       7                 :            : namespace isc {
       8                 :            : namespace resolve {
       9                 :            : 
      10                 :            : extern const isc::log::MessageID RESLIB_ANSWER = "RESLIB_ANSWER";
      11                 :            : extern const isc::log::MessageID RESLIB_CNAME = "RESLIB_CNAME";
      12                 :            : extern const isc::log::MessageID RESLIB_DEEPEST = "RESLIB_DEEPEST";
      13                 :            : extern const isc::log::MessageID RESLIB_EMPTY_RESPONSE = "RESLIB_EMPTY_RESPONSE";
      14                 :            : extern const isc::log::MessageID RESLIB_ERROR_RESPONSE = "RESLIB_ERROR_RESPONSE";
      15                 :            : extern const isc::log::MessageID RESLIB_EXTRADATA_RESPONSE = "RESLIB_EXTRADATA_RESPONSE";
      16                 :            : extern const isc::log::MessageID RESLIB_FOLLOW_CNAME = "RESLIB_FOLLOW_CNAME";
      17                 :            : extern const isc::log::MessageID RESLIB_INVALID_NAMECLASS_RESPONSE = "RESLIB_INVALID_NAMECLASS_RESPONSE";
      18                 :            : extern const isc::log::MessageID RESLIB_INVALID_QNAME_RESPONSE = "RESLIB_INVALID_QNAME_RESPONSE";
      19                 :            : extern const isc::log::MessageID RESLIB_INVALID_TYPE_RESPONSE = "RESLIB_INVALID_TYPE_RESPONSE";
      20                 :            : extern const isc::log::MessageID RESLIB_LONG_CHAIN = "RESLIB_LONG_CHAIN";
      21                 :            : extern const isc::log::MessageID RESLIB_MULTIPLE_CLASS_RESPONSE = "RESLIB_MULTIPLE_CLASS_RESPONSE";
      22                 :            : extern const isc::log::MessageID RESLIB_NOTSINGLE_RESPONSE = "RESLIB_NOTSINGLE_RESPONSE";
      23                 :            : extern const isc::log::MessageID RESLIB_NOT_ONE_QNAME_RESPONSE = "RESLIB_NOT_ONE_QNAME_RESPONSE";
      24                 :            : extern const isc::log::MessageID RESLIB_NOT_RESPONSE = "RESLIB_NOT_RESPONSE";
      25                 :            : extern const isc::log::MessageID RESLIB_NO_NS_RRSET = "RESLIB_NO_NS_RRSET";
      26                 :            : extern const isc::log::MessageID RESLIB_NSAS_LOOKUP = "RESLIB_NSAS_LOOKUP";
      27                 :            : extern const isc::log::MessageID RESLIB_NXDOM_NXRR = "RESLIB_NXDOM_NXRR";
      28                 :            : extern const isc::log::MessageID RESLIB_OPCODE_RESPONSE = "RESLIB_OPCODE_RESPONSE";
      29                 :            : extern const isc::log::MessageID RESLIB_PROTOCOL = "RESLIB_PROTOCOL";
      30                 :            : extern const isc::log::MessageID RESLIB_PROTOCOL_RETRY = "RESLIB_PROTOCOL_RETRY";
      31                 :            : extern const isc::log::MessageID RESLIB_RCODE_ERROR = "RESLIB_RCODE_ERROR";
      32                 :            : extern const isc::log::MessageID RESLIB_RECQ_CACHE_FIND = "RESLIB_RECQ_CACHE_FIND";
      33                 :            : extern const isc::log::MessageID RESLIB_RECQ_CACHE_NO_FIND = "RESLIB_RECQ_CACHE_NO_FIND";
      34                 :            : extern const isc::log::MessageID RESLIB_REFERRAL = "RESLIB_REFERRAL";
      35                 :            : extern const isc::log::MessageID RESLIB_REFER_ZONE = "RESLIB_REFER_ZONE";
      36                 :            : extern const isc::log::MessageID RESLIB_RESOLVE = "RESLIB_RESOLVE";
      37                 :            : extern const isc::log::MessageID RESLIB_RRSET_FOUND = "RESLIB_RRSET_FOUND";
      38                 :            : extern const isc::log::MessageID RESLIB_RTT = "RESLIB_RTT";
      39                 :            : extern const isc::log::MessageID RESLIB_RUNQ_CACHE_FIND = "RESLIB_RUNQ_CACHE_FIND";
      40                 :            : extern const isc::log::MessageID RESLIB_RUNQ_CACHE_LOOKUP = "RESLIB_RUNQ_CACHE_LOOKUP";
      41                 :            : extern const isc::log::MessageID RESLIB_RUNQ_FAIL = "RESLIB_RUNQ_FAIL";
      42                 :            : extern const isc::log::MessageID RESLIB_RUNQ_SUCCESS = "RESLIB_RUNQ_SUCCESS";
      43                 :            : extern const isc::log::MessageID RESLIB_TCP_TRUNCATED = "RESLIB_TCP_TRUNCATED";
      44                 :            : extern const isc::log::MessageID RESLIB_TEST_SERVER = "RESLIB_TEST_SERVER";
      45                 :            : extern const isc::log::MessageID RESLIB_TEST_UPSTREAM = "RESLIB_TEST_UPSTREAM";
      46                 :            : extern const isc::log::MessageID RESLIB_TIMEOUT = "RESLIB_TIMEOUT";
      47                 :            : extern const isc::log::MessageID RESLIB_TIMEOUT_RETRY = "RESLIB_TIMEOUT_RETRY";
      48                 :            : extern const isc::log::MessageID RESLIB_TRUNCATED = "RESLIB_TRUNCATED";
      49                 :            : extern const isc::log::MessageID RESLIB_UPSTREAM = "RESLIB_UPSTREAM";
      50                 :            : 
      51                 :            : } // namespace resolve
      52                 :            : } // namespace isc
      53                 :            : 
      54                 :            : namespace {
      55                 :            : 
      56                 :            : const char* values[] = {
      57                 :            :     "RESLIB_ANSWER", "answer received in response to query for <%1>",
      58                 :            :     "RESLIB_CNAME", "CNAME received in response to query for <%1>",
      59                 :            :     "RESLIB_DEEPEST", "did not find <%1> in cache, deepest delegation found is %2",
      60                 :            :     "RESLIB_EMPTY_RESPONSE", "empty response received to query for <%1>",
      61                 :            :     "RESLIB_ERROR_RESPONSE", "unspecified error received in response to query for <%1>",
      62                 :            :     "RESLIB_EXTRADATA_RESPONSE", "extra data in response to query for <%1>",
      63                 :            :     "RESLIB_FOLLOW_CNAME", "following CNAME chain to <%1>",
      64                 :            :     "RESLIB_INVALID_NAMECLASS_RESPONSE", "invalid name or class in response to query for <%1>",
      65                 :            :     "RESLIB_INVALID_QNAME_RESPONSE", "invalid name or class in response to query for <%1>",
      66                 :            :     "RESLIB_INVALID_TYPE_RESPONSE", "invalid name or class in response to query for <%1>",
      67                 :            :     "RESLIB_LONG_CHAIN", "CNAME received in response to query for <%1>: CNAME chain length exceeded",
      68                 :            :     "RESLIB_MULTIPLE_CLASS_RESPONSE", "response to query for <%1> contained multiple RRsets with different classes",
      69                 :            :     "RESLIB_NOTSINGLE_RESPONSE", "response to query for <%1> was not a response",
      70                 :            :     "RESLIB_NOT_ONE_QNAME_RESPONSE", "not one question in response to query for <%1>",
      71                 :            :     "RESLIB_NOT_RESPONSE", "response to query for <%1> was not a response",
      72                 :            :     "RESLIB_NO_NS_RRSET", "no NS RRSet in referral response received to query for <%1>",
      73                 :            :     "RESLIB_NSAS_LOOKUP", "looking up nameserver for zone %1 in the NSAS",
      74                 :            :     "RESLIB_NXDOM_NXRR", "NXDOMAIN/NXRRSET received in response to query for <%1>",
      75                 :            :     "RESLIB_OPCODE_RESPONSE", "response to query for <%1> did not have query opcode",
      76                 :            :     "RESLIB_PROTOCOL", "protocol error in answer for %1:  %3",
      77                 :            :     "RESLIB_PROTOCOL_RETRY", "protocol error in answer for %1: %2 (retries left: %3)",
      78                 :            :     "RESLIB_RCODE_ERROR", "response to query for <%1> returns RCODE of %2",
      79                 :            :     "RESLIB_RECQ_CACHE_FIND", "found <%1> in the cache (resolve() instance %2)",
      80                 :            :     "RESLIB_RECQ_CACHE_NO_FIND", "did not find <%1> in the cache, starting RunningQuery (resolve() instance %2)",
      81                 :            :     "RESLIB_REFERRAL", "referral received in response to query for <%1>",
      82                 :            :     "RESLIB_REFER_ZONE", "referred to zone %1",
      83                 :            :     "RESLIB_RESOLVE", "asked to resolve <%1> (resolve() instance %2)",
      84                 :            :     "RESLIB_RRSET_FOUND", "found single RRset in the cache when querying for <%1> (resolve() instance %2)",
      85                 :            :     "RESLIB_RTT", "round-trip time of last query calculated as %1 ms",
      86                 :            :     "RESLIB_RUNQ_CACHE_FIND", "found <%1> in the cache",
      87                 :            :     "RESLIB_RUNQ_CACHE_LOOKUP", "looking up up <%1> in the cache",
      88                 :            :     "RESLIB_RUNQ_FAIL", "failure callback - nameservers are unreachable",
      89                 :            :     "RESLIB_RUNQ_SUCCESS", "success callback - sending query to %1",
      90                 :            :     "RESLIB_TCP_TRUNCATED", "TCP response to query for %1 was truncated",
      91                 :            :     "RESLIB_TEST_SERVER", "setting test server to %1(%2)",
      92                 :            :     "RESLIB_TEST_UPSTREAM", "sending upstream query for <%1> to test server at %2",
      93                 :            :     "RESLIB_TIMEOUT", "query <%1> to %2 timed out",
      94                 :            :     "RESLIB_TIMEOUT_RETRY", "query <%1> to %2 timed out, re-trying (retries left: %3)",
      95                 :            :     "RESLIB_TRUNCATED", "response to query for <%1> was truncated, re-querying over TCP",
      96                 :            :     "RESLIB_UPSTREAM", "sending upstream query for <%1> to %2",
      97                 :            :     NULL
      98                 :            : };
      99                 :            : 
     100                 :          2 : const isc::log::MessageInitializer initializer(values);
     101                 :            : 
     102                 :          2 : } // Anonymous namespace
     103                 :            : 

Generated by: LCOV version 1.9